AI Agents Breaking Out of Controlled Tests Becomes a New Security Trend
moyix · x · 2026-08-03
Cybersecurity firm Xbow discusses the alarming trend of AI agents breaking out of controlled tests to hack companies in their latest podcast episode.
Featuring security researchers like @moyix, the episode unpacks why these breaches occur, what they mean for enterprise security, and how organizations can implement controls to stay safe.
